I scoured the web for a decent looking 3G icon in CommManager and they were not pleasing to the eye. I am NOT an artist, in fact I suck at it :) but mine still look better than the alternatives and I provide the black and white CAB of the images to match most themes.

Here is my 3G icon CAB for Comm Manager based on this post: http://www.fuzemobility.com/how-to-disable-3g/
  • Why do you need this? Because turning off 3G makes my Touch Pro (AT&T Fuze) battery last longer, about 2-3 days instead of having to charge daily. Low 3G reception areas cause the phone to keep looking hard for that 3G signal. EDGE network is a trade-off, my other software has support have plenty of web browsers that are optimized for low-speed, so I only turn on 3G when I truly need some internet speed.

  • Only for GSM phones

  • Does not work on Touch Pro 2 or Diamond 2. My guess is it will no longer work for newer devices as HTC has disabled this hidden feature in Comm Manager. Use my app, JZ SmartMort which has a macro/script to turn 3G on and off. It's the only thing I can offer for newer devices.

  • It will replace whatever button is in the 5th position (look at the screenshots below), usually "Microsoft Direct Push" is in that position.

  • To restore Microsoft Direct Push back to position #5 in CommManager, you can do either of the following.
    • Uninstall my CAB and it will reverse the single registry change.
    • Using the Advanced Config Tool (Right-Menu -> More Settings -> Comm Manager) the order of the buttons can easily be changed.
    • Modify the registry for that 5th button HKLM\Software\HTC\CommManager\5\(Default) change "3G" string that my CAB put there to "AUTD", which basically means MS Direct Push.

  • The most important thing that the CAB provides is the four images that will end up in \Windows folder. After the CAB is installed, you have to kill CommManager.exe if it's running or take a reboot before seeing the new button/image.

  • This will work on VGA, QVGA and other devices running the "Diamond" or "Opal" version of CommManager (verify with screenshots below) and it should work on all ported versions of CommManager as well.

  • Tested on:
    • HTC Raphael / Touch Pro / Fuze
    • HTC Tytn II / Kaiser / Tilt --- (needs HTC CommManager like shown below not the original blue Microsoft one)

I tested further and found out that my CAB will put the registry setting back to MS Direct Push when my CAB is uninstalled. This is the registry value: HKLM\Software\HTC\CommManager\5\(Default) = "AUTD"

Again, the answer is YES my CAB will put reverse the single registry change that it makes, I forgot about that general feature of CAB files.

Is your Diamond CDMA or GSM?

Keep in mind this is not a hack, this is default functionality for that Comm Manager. My CAB simply changes one of the buttons to a predefined string in the registry, not something that I came up with. The only thing that I provide is the images... take a look at this website and you will see that this is a known mod for these devices but only GSM not CDMA versions of the devices. I will change the first post to reflect that.

Take a look at this thread, this mod has been out for a while:
http://www.fuzemobility.com/how-to-disable-3g/

When you use this mod w/o my CAB, the button will still work but will have an empty image which I certainly did not like, hence my effort.
